Output 21ba904d026d72b26fec8d4562e0dbbd6353d4f4268b84a5b4e487b2d05ebdaf:0

value
3430000
script pubkey
OP_0 OP_PUSHBYTES_20 87f4b5683bcf2df065632c090deaa38e7e2e1de3
address
bc1qsl6t26pmeuklqetr9sysm64r3elzu80r7cgzkf
transaction
21ba904d026d72b26fec8d4562e0dbbd6353d4f4268b84a5b4e487b2d05ebdaf
confirmations
166790
spent
true